The Production

The Ten Commandments was a massive production that involved hundreds of crew members, thousands of extras, and a budget of over $13 million (approximately $120 million in today's dollars). The film was shot on location in Egypt, Israel, and California, and features some of the most impressive special effects of its time.

The film's iconic parting of the Red Sea scene, which shows the Hebrews escaping from the pursuing Egyptian army, was achieved using a combination of matte paintings, miniatures, and live-action footage. The scene has become one of the most famous in movie history and continues to awe audiences to this day.

The Music

The score for The Ten Commandments was composed by Elmer Bernstein, who created a memorable and haunting theme that complements the film's epic scope. The score features a range of instruments, including orchestral and choral pieces, and has become an integral part of the film's enduring appeal.

To truly understand the "deep content" of the film beyond the audio tracks, consider these production milestones:

The Plot: The film dramatizes the life of Moses (Charlton Heston), an adopted Egyptian prince who discovers his Hebrew heritage and leads his people out of slavery.

Historical Accuracy vs. Interpretation: While based on the Book of Exodus, the screenplay also draws from ancient texts by Philo, Josephus, and Eusebius to fill in the "silent years" of Moses' life in Egypt. Cinematic Innovation:

VistaVision: It was shot in a high-resolution 35mm format called VistaVision, which provides the incredible detail seen in modern 4K restorations.

The Parting of the Red Sea: This iconic scene remains one of the most famous special effects in history and helped the film win its only Academy Award.

Voice of God: In a notable "deep" detail, the voice of God in the film was provided by Charlton Heston himself, electronically altered to sound booming and divine.
